Commit Graph

1169 Commits

Author SHA1 Message Date
Fredrik Adelöw 7310df3ab3 Merge pull request #14727 from backstage/freben/more-lint
some more progress toward ubiquitous eslint-plugin-testing-library
2022-11-23 11:20:52 +01:00
Johan Haals 6d4699a810 Merge pull request #14765 from malin-mallan/#14602_deprecations
Remove some deprecations
2022-11-23 10:56:05 +01:00
Fredrik Adelöw 3bd6cc7c55 some more progress toward ubiquitous eslint-plugin-testing-library
Signed-off-by: Fredrik Adelöw <freben@gmail.com>
2022-11-23 09:28:37 +01:00
github-actions[bot] 83d3167594 Version Packages (next) 2022-11-22 15:40:52 +00:00
MALIN WIDÈN ddd5c87ffb Change Buffer.from to window.btoa
Signed-off-by: MALIN WIDÈN <malwi130@student.liu.se>
2022-11-22 15:35:50 +01:00
Ben Lambert 0d56fac516 Merge pull request #14660 from dagda1/stepper-form-data
initialize all formData in next/Stepper
2022-11-22 13:19:47 +01:00
Ben Lambert 68b81e8c32 Merge pull request #14132 from acierto/scaffolder-result-content
Make scaffolder last step (summary overview) configurable by the user
2022-11-22 11:46:18 +01:00
blam 8dbc3fb649 chore: fixing api-reports
Signed-off-by: blam <ben@blam.sh>
2022-11-22 11:13:24 +01:00
blam eb2b9db729 chore: fixing types for uiSchema
Signed-off-by: blam <ben@blam.sh>
2022-11-22 10:44:29 +01:00
renovate[bot] 3280711113 Update dependency msw to ^0.49.0
Signed-off-by: Renovate Bot <bot@renovateapp.com>
2022-11-22 04:34:08 +00:00
bogdannechyporenko a75a2da2f2 Merge remote-tracking branch 'origin/master' into scaffolder-result-content
# Conflicts:
#	plugins/scaffolder/src/components/TemplatePage/TemplatePage.tsx
2022-11-21 21:27:32 +01:00
MALIN WIDÈN 9e4fbf0ff4 Remove some deprecations
Signed-off-by: MALIN WIDÈN <malwi130@student.liu.se>
2022-11-21 17:20:14 +01:00
Paul Cowan 0788ba9887 run prettier
Signed-off-by: Paul Cowan <paul.cowan@cutting.scot>
2022-11-21 13:14:32 +00:00
Paul Cowan ef803022f1 nitialize all formData in next/Stepper
Signed-off-by: Paul Cowan <paul.cowan@cutting.scot>
2022-11-21 13:14:31 +00:00
Fredrik Adelöw b1af1205cd Merge pull request #14699 from alexrybch/scaffolder-template-header-options
Pass headerOptions to TemplatePage
2022-11-18 16:38:15 +01:00
Alex Rybchenko a63e2df559 pass headerOptions to TemplatePage
Signed-off-by: Alex Rybchenko <arybchenko@box.com>
2022-11-18 13:38:23 +01:00
Fredrik Adelöw cb716004ef add some eslint rules for testing-library use in tests
Signed-off-by: Fredrik Adelöw <freben@gmail.com>
2022-11-18 11:29:20 +01:00
bogdannechyporenko db05621272 Merge remote-tracking branch 'origin/master' into scaffolder-result-content 2022-11-17 20:07:32 +01:00
Fredrik Adelöw 3228a8a951 Merge pull request #14667 from dagda1/transform-errors
give the ability to supply a transformErrors function to the rjsf/core
2022-11-17 16:49:58 +01:00
bogdannechyporenko dc0a9956aa Merge remote-tracking branch 'origin/master' into scaffolder-result-content 2022-11-17 16:38:32 +01:00
bnechyporenko 464d3df31c Updated api-report.md
Signed-off-by: bnechyporenko <bnechyporenko@bol.com>
2022-11-17 10:40:21 +01:00
bnechyporenko ccd088d7cc Merge remote-tracking branch 'origin/master' into scaffolder-result-content
# Conflicts:
#	plugins/scaffolder/api-report.md
#	plugins/scaffolder/src/plugin.tsx
2022-11-17 10:33:53 +01:00
renovate[bot] 19356df560 Update dependency zen-observable to ^0.9.0
Signed-off-by: Renovate Bot <bot@renovateapp.com>
2022-11-17 09:09:51 +00:00
Johan Haals 167d5baad2 Merge pull request #14008 from kuangp/feat/fieldExplorer
[PRFC] Custom Field Extension Explorer
2022-11-17 09:58:39 +01:00
bogdannechyporenko a409deabb0 Merge remote-tracking branch 'origin/master' into scaffolder-result-content 2022-11-16 21:22:20 +01:00
Paul Cowan dff3af350b remove onChange handler
Signed-off-by: Paul Cowan <paul.cowan@cutting.scot>
2022-11-16 15:56:34 +00:00
Paul Cowan 8e3a366dc4 rim api-reports
Signed-off-by: Paul Cowan <paul.cowan@cutting.scot>
2022-11-16 15:56:33 +00:00
Paul Cowan adb1b01e32 give the ability to supply a transformErrors function to the Stepper form
Signed-off-by: Paul Cowan <paul.cowan@cutting.scot>
2022-11-16 15:56:33 +00:00
github-actions[bot] 3164131851 Version Packages 2022-11-15 12:31:55 +00:00
bnechyporenko c00b83e22c Reverted
Signed-off-by: bnechyporenko <bnechyporenko@bol.com>
2022-11-15 08:59:02 +01:00
bnechyporenko a68694190a Merge remote-tracking branch 'origin/master' into scaffolder-result-content 2022-11-15 08:58:26 +01:00
Phil Kuang da25293910 refactor(scaffolder): wrap full field schema and prop type def in helper
Signed-off-by: Phil Kuang <pkuang@factset.com>
2022-11-14 11:41:42 -05:00
Patrik Oldsberg ef8787cab0 Merge pull request #14370 from afscrome/patch-4
Fix casing of EntityNamePicker validation error message
2022-11-14 16:07:47 +01:00
Alex Crome 4d23a5c7b2 Fix casing of EntityNamePicker validation error message
The error message for `EntityNamePicker` has two sentences.  The first word of the second sentence is capitalised, but the first sentence was not.  This fixes the capitalisation of the first sentence.

Signed-off-by: Alex Crome <afscrome@users.noreply.github.com>
2022-11-11 20:42:45 +00:00
Phil Kuang 3e4a2ee779 docs(scaffolder): add info about custom field explorer
Signed-off-by: Phil Kuang <pkuang@factset.com>
2022-11-11 14:37:10 -05:00
Phil Kuang aa4438e341 refactor(scaffolder): abstract away zod schema types
Signed-off-by: Phil Kuang <pkuang@factset.com>
2022-11-11 14:37:10 -05:00
Phil Kuang ddd1c3308d feat(scaffolder): implement custom field explorer
Signed-off-by: Phil Kuang <pkuang@factset.com>
2022-11-11 14:37:10 -05:00
blam 0a0365e877 chore: fixing the return type in the api-report
Signed-off-by: blam <ben@blam.sh>
2022-11-11 12:08:14 +01:00
blam d293d8ec22 chore: heres the actual fix
Signed-off-by: blam <ben@blam.sh>
2022-11-10 17:41:08 +01:00
blam c1f5541d5c chore: fixing the type for the return of the createNextScaffolderFieldExtension
Signed-off-by: blam <ben@blam.sh>
2022-11-10 17:35:09 +01:00
Fredrik Adelöw 94b7ca9c6d fixup
Signed-off-by: Fredrik Adelöw <freben@gmail.com>
2022-11-09 13:15:49 +01:00
renovate[bot] e13cd3feaf Update dependency msw to ^0.48.0
Signed-off-by: Renovate Bot <bot@renovateapp.com>
2022-11-09 10:15:16 +00:00
github-actions[bot] b01fea7b8c Version Packages (next) 2022-11-08 14:04:37 +00:00
blam 43d66cef85 chore: pass through the form data like before in the context
Signed-off-by: blam <ben@blam.sh>
2022-11-07 13:58:40 +01:00
Eric Peterson 580285787d Add create and click analytics events to 'next' create page
Signed-off-by: Eric Peterson <ericpeterson@spotify.com>
2022-11-04 12:45:29 +01:00
bnechyporenko d4af3731fb Wip
Signed-off-by: bnechyporenko <bnechyporenko@bol.com>
2022-10-27 09:34:31 +02:00
bogdannechyporenko 4713e9dd06 Updated api-report.md
Signed-off-by: bogdannechyporenko <bogdannechiporenko@gmail.com>
2022-10-26 23:04:06 +02:00
bogdannechyporenko 59f4917e82 Hidden Step type back
Signed-off-by: bogdannechyporenko <bogdannechiporenko@gmail.com>
2022-10-26 22:15:47 +02:00
bogdannechyporenko f16fa9b0bf A small change
Signed-off-by: bogdannechyporenko <bogdannechiporenko@gmail.com>
2022-10-26 22:12:24 +02:00
bogdannechyporenko 026f269b0e Merge remote-tracking branch 'origin/master' into scaffolder-result-content 2022-10-26 22:03:28 +02:00